Types of Air Systems Available



A variety of air systems are available to satisfy varied demands across property, business, and commercial setups. Among one of the most common kinds are main air conditioning systems, which provide comprehensive environment control through a network of air ducts. These systems are perfect for bigger spaces, guaranteeing constant temperature and air quality.


Ductless mini-split systems provide a versatile choice, enabling targeted cooling and home heating in details zones without the demand for ductwork. This is particularly valuable in older structures or for enhancements where air duct installation might not be feasible.


For industrial applications, roof units (RTUs) prevail. These self-contained systems provide effective heating, air conditioning, and ventilation and are made for toughness sought after atmospheres.


Additionally, evaporative colders take advantage of the natural procedure of evaporation to cool down air, making them a cost-efficient choice in dry environments. Mobile air conditioning unit offer adaptability for momentary cooling options, suitable for rooms that require flexibility or are not geared up with long-term systems.

Upkeep and Maintenance Tips



Routine maintenance and upkeep are vital for making sure ideal performance and longevity of air systems. To attain this, it is critical to establish a regular maintenance schedule that consists of filter replacements, cleansing, and system evaluations. Air filters should be inspected monthly and changed every three months, or extra often in dusty atmospheres, to maintain air flow performance and interior air quality.


Additionally, routine cleaning of the evaporator and condenser coils can stop getting too hot and enhance energy efficiency. Ensure that the condensate drainpipe is clear to prevent water damages and mold and mildew development. Check ductwork for leaks or clogs, which can substantially reduce system efficiency.


Expert inspections ought to be conducted at the very least yearly to recognize prospective issues early and guarantee conformity with safety and security requirements. Throughout these assessments, service technicians can likewise calibrate thermostats and inspect refrigerant degrees.
